Fabtech's Drive Line Spacer increases spline contact and restores proper driveline angle after lifting a vehicle.

Fabtech Performance produces quality lifted suspension systems, leveling kits and shock absorbers. The company is headquarted in Chino, California. The five-acre Fabtech campus houses the product development team and the hi-tech, state-of-the-art manufacturing facility. The company manufacturers accessories for GMC, Chevrolet, Dodge, Ram, Hummer, Jeep, Nissan and Toyota off-road vehicles as well as for UTVs. Select FabTech suspension systems are FMVSS 126-certified and come with a 60,000 mile or five year Powertrain Warranty. The reason Fabtech can afford to give such a generous warranty is that they rigorously test their products on the vehicles of real customers. They install the suspension systems on the trucks, Jeeps and SUVs of random customers for free. The customers drive the vehicles like they normally would. And Fabtech regularly checks the customer's vehicle to moniter how the suspension components are performing and enduring. It is this real world testing that gives Fabtech products the quality edge.
